POSITION SUMMARY

The National Director (ND) will lead the Habitat for Humanity (HFH) Vietnam in fulfilling its critical, complex role as housing expert, convener, and lead implementer of innovative housing solutions. The ND is accountable to lead, direct, develop and manage HFHI resources ensuring quality, effectiveness and accountability in line with HFHI policies, protocols and standards. This role is also responsible for developing the capacity of the Branch Office to fulfill the purposes of Habitat for Humanity Vietnam. The position enables sound organizational growth through effective strategic and operational development, with an emphasis on collaboration, innovation and quality programming in alignment with HFHIs strategic goals.

Habitat for Humanity Vietnam is seeking a visionary and transformative National Director (ND) to lead its strategic direction, partnerships, and national impact. The ND serves as Habitat Vietnam’s chief representative and is responsible for strategy, operational excellence, resource development, stakeholder engagement, and safeguarding.

POSITION RESPONSIBILITIES

The National Director must be a compelling, transformative leader with 10+ years of NGO or development sector leadership experience encompassing the following:

• Casts a clear and transformative vision for the future of HFH Vietnam in alignment to the Regional and Global Strategic Framework, to position the organization as a leader in housing and a key convener to work within the housing system
• Builds a highly competent leadership team and empowering agile organizational culture capable of developing and implementing organizational strategy.
• Leads a wide range of diverse internal and external stakeholders through complex organizational change.
• Builds and leads multi-sector coalitions and strategic partnerships to successfully scale solutions and advocacy impact and expand funding support.
• Orchestrates wide-spread public and donor engagement and support of the organization's mission and strategy through a clearly articulated value proposition.
• Secures funding to support evidence-based, innovative, scalable solutions.
• Navigates the complexity of matrixed NGO structures, demonstrating collaboration with and accountability to local communities as well as local and international governance structures.
• Oversees operational excellence of a direct service organization, including safeguarding, financial management, monitoring and evaluation, and other quality controls.

POSITION REQUIREMENTS

EDUCATION

  • Bachelor’s degree in a relevant field such as international development, international relations, public administration, management, civil engineering, or social sciences.
  • Master’s degree preferred.

YEARS OF RELATED EXPERIENCE

  • Minimum of Ten (10) years in a senior leadership role (Country Director, Chief of Party, senior Program Development/Program Management) in a humanitarian or development organization.
  • Track record in stewardship, servant leadership, and strategic organizational management.
  • Experience leading and building coalitions across public, civil society, non-profit, academic, and private sectors.
  • Demonstrated ability to mobilize resources through partnerships.
  • Proven track record in advocacy, with preference for experience in policy advocacy.

About

Habitat for Humanity International (HFHI) is a nonprofit, ecumenical Christian housing ministry. The purpose and goal of Habitat for Humanity International is to eliminate poverty housing and homelessness from the world, and to make decent shelter a matter of conscience and action. Habitat invites people of all backgrounds, races and religions to build houses in partnership with families in need. HFHI has an Administrative Headquarters based in Atlanta, Georgia, an Operational Headquarters based in Americus, Georgia and Area Office bases of operations in Manila, Philippines for our Asia and the Pacific work, San Jose, Costa Rica for our Latin American and the Caribbean work, and Bratislava, Slovakia, for our Europe, the Middle East and Africa work.
